First, some definitions are in order. An “Income Property” can simply be defined as one that has tenants. A property without tenants is not an income property. Such real estate would include apartment buildings, shopping centers, office buildings, and even “self-storage” among other types.
Accounting is used to build the income statements, and Finance is employed to analyze what they mean. Such calculations would involve “equity dividend rates”, “maximum down payment estimates”, “CAP” rates, “cash-break-even-ratios”, and “debt-service-coverage-ratios” among others.
